Grades 9 - 12 from area high schools
Youth and Government is a club open to high school students at Cary, Green Hope, and Panther Creek High Schools. It is a program that enables young people to train for political leadership through instruction in the theory and practice of developing public policy. Students will plan, research, and develop bills which will be submitted for review. Selected bills will be read, researched, examined, and debated at the YMCA North Carolina Youth & Government Conference held the third weekend in February. Delegates attending the conference will learn and demonstrate proper parliamentary procedures in presenting and supporting the bills. Members can attend a statewide conference in Feb.
